brake lights and turn signals
My turn signals work fine until you hit the brakes and then they stop. The light on the dash even glows but won't blink. That kind of stinks when you consider most of the time when you're turning you hit the brakes. Any ideas on where my problem could be? They all work fine by themselves, but can't seem to get along. thanks in advance for any info.....

Re: brake lights and turn signals
First thing I'd do is replace all four turn signal bulbs (external...front and rear) with brand new 1157 bulbs.
Then inspect wires... like where the harness had been hacked up for a trailer. Your grounds should be fine.... don't bother going there. swap the 2 flashers one for the other.... Do your 4 ways work? I seem toremember a truck doing this when the 4 way flasher switch was pushed in and broken off... and the flasher was removed. |
